A FATHER and son from Bridgwater took part in a charity challenge in memory of a close friend.
Steve Darch and Matt Darch walked the Two Moors Way from Wembury in South Devon to Lynmouth in North Devon, which is a total of 116 miles across both Dartmoor and Exmoor.
The pair were raising funds for St Margaret’s Hospice in Taunton and dedicated their walk in memory of their close friend, Phill Evans.
A total of £2058.33 was raised and donated in a cheque presentation to community fundraiser for the hospice, Julie Draper.
Steve and Matt would like to thank everyone who sponsored and supported them throughout their walk.
Julie Draper said: "We are extremely grateful to Steve and Matt for this fantastic donation and for completing such a fantastic challenge.
"It was a real pleasure to meet them both."
